Research on PTSD in March 2026 focused heavily on psychedelic and pharmacological treatments, with meta-analyses showing MDMA-assisted therapy reduces PTSD symptoms (SMDs around -0.71 to -1.19) but with very low certainty evidence and concerns about blinding and expectancy. Ketamine and ibogaine also showed promise, with ketamine's dissociative effects resembling PTSD brain states and ibogaine linked to brain network changes correlating with symptom improvement. However, evidence is limited by small samples, short follow-ups, and methodological flaws, and no definitive conclusions can be drawn for most treatments.

A mindfulness-based intervention significantly lowered PTSD levels in domestic violence survivors, with reductions in intrusion, avoidance, and hypervigilance scores.

quasi-experimental one-group pre-test post-test design Sample size: 7

MDMA-assisted therapy reduced PTSD symptoms more than control conditions (Hedges' g = -0.71), with higher dosing sessions and cumulative dose associated with larger effects, though certainty was low.

systematic review and meta-analysis Sample size: 286

The review argues that (R,S)-ketamine's therapeutic effects involve specific brain circuits and BDNF-TrkB signaling, while NMDA receptor antagonism may be unrelated to efficacy.

review

Ibogaine-induced posterior shifts in high-beta brain networks correlated with PTSD symptom improvements and may serve as a biomarker for its therapeutic effects.

observational study Sample size: 30

MDMA-assisted psychotherapy for PTSD has shown promising outcomes in randomized controlled trials but faces significant methodological limitations and has not received FDA approval due to insufficient evidence.

review

Prazosin has the best evidence base for treating PTSD-related nightmares, and alternative alpha-1 blockers may be effective when prazosin is not feasible.

review

MDMA-assisted therapy was associated with reductions in PTSD symptom severity and dissociative symptoms, and may improve functioning, but the certainty of the evidence was very low.

systematic review and meta-analysis Sample size: 298

MDMA and ketamine IV currently have the greatest support in the literature for efficacy in PTSD, though caution is needed due to expectancy and blinding limitations.

review

Argues that the term 'flashback' has been applied inconsistently across psychedelic and PTSD research, leading to conceptual confusion that hinders scientific clarity.

historical analysis

Proposes that dissociative and non-dissociative PTSD involve distinct disruptions in the predictive processing hierarchy of prior beliefs, interoception, and exteroception, with sense of agency impairments specific to the dissociative subtype.

theoretical or philosophical paper

Dissociative states, whether induced by ketamine in healthy volunteers or present in PTSD patients, are associated with increased dominance of the default mode network meta-state and decreased dominance of the somatomotor network meta-state.

observational cohort with experimental manipulation and secondary analysis of clinical trial data Sample size: 108

Proposes that combining ketamine and prazosin may improve PTSD and AUD outcomes through complementary mechanisms, though untested in trials.

theoretical or philosophical paper

Points of agreement

  • MDMA-assisted therapy shows consistent evidence of reducing PTSD symptoms across meta-analyses, though with low certainty.
  • Ketamine and ibogaine show promise for PTSD, with ketamine's dissociative effects resembling PTSD brain states and ibogaine linked to brain network changes.
  • Prazosin is supported for PTSD-related nightmares, with alternative alpha-1 blockers as potential options.
  • Methodological limitations such as blinding, expectancy, and small samples are common across psychedelic and pharmacological studies.

Conflicts

  • One meta-analysis (article 27849) reported a smaller effect size (g = -0.71) compared to another (article 25094) with SMD = -1.19, possibly due to different inclusion criteria or analyses.
  • The review on MDMA-AT (article 25110) notes FDA declined approval due to insufficient evidence, while other reviews (article 24928) suggest MDMA has the greatest support, reflecting differing interpretations of the evidence base.

Gaps

  • Durability of treatment effects beyond short-term follow-up is not well established.
  • Blinding and expectancy effects are inadequately addressed in most psychedelic trials.
  • Sample sizes are small, limiting generalizability.
  • Head-to-head comparisons of different treatment models and active comparator conditions are lacking.
  • Safety monitoring and long-term adverse effects are insufficiently studied.
  • Most research focuses on MDMA and ketamine; other psychedelics like psilocybin and LSD require more RCTs.
